What Is AAAD APK?
AAAD stands for Android Auto Apps Downloader. It is a tool that helps users install third-party apps on Android Auto systems.
Normally, Android Auto only supports approved apps from Google. AAAD APK gives users access to additional apps that are not officially available through the Play Store.
Some people use AAAD APK to install:
- Video streaming apps
- Screen mirroring tools
- Custom navigation apps
- Media players
Because of these features, AAAD APK has gained attention among Android Auto enthusiasts.
Do I Have to Root My Phone to Use AAAD APK?
No, you usually do not have to root your phone to use AAAD APK.
One of the biggest reasons for AAAD APK’s popularity is that it works on many non-rooted Android devices. This makes it more beginner-friendly compared to older Android modification methods.
In the past, users often needed root access to install unofficial Android Auto apps. Today, AAAD simplifies the process and reduces the need for advanced system changes.
However, compatibility can depend on:
- Your Android version
- Android Auto updates
- Device manufacturer restrictions
Some advanced features may still require root access, but basic use generally does not.

Risks and Things to Consider
Although AAAD APK can be useful, there are some important considerations.
Security Concerns
Downloading APK files from unofficial sources can expose your device to malware or harmful software.
Android Auto Restrictions
Google frequently updates Android Auto security policies. Some unofficial apps may stop working after updates.
Potential Stability Issues
Third-party apps can sometimes crash or behave unpredictably while driving.
Warranty and Support
Even though rooting may not be required, modifying Android Auto settings could still affect official support in some situations.
